Techniques for Plastering Lightweight Concrete Block Walls
Plaster thickness up to 1.5 cm:
You can plaster directly to the desired thickness. First, press and smooth a thin layer of plaster with a trowel, then add more plaster to reach the required thickness.
Plaster thickness between 1.5 and 2.5 cm:
Apply plaster to a thickness of 1–1.5 cm and wait until it sets to a damp stage. Then add the remaining plaster to reach the desired thickness and wait for it to set again. (Do not make the plaster too watery, as this may cause sagging.)
Plaster thickness exceeding 2.5 cm:
Cracking may occur later. It is recommended to install #125 wire mesh fully over the areas with thick plaster before applying the plaster layers.
When the plaster has set to a firm damp state, you can use a triangular trowel to level the surface, then fill in any low spots, level again, and finally do the finishing plaster work as needed.
After finishing the plaster, when it starts to set but is still damp and firm, you can spray water with a brush to create a smooth, bubbly surface texture immediately. After spraying water, it is recommended to brush the surface to achieve a smooth and beautiful finish.
